使用golang的gin框架写一个MVC这是service中的dto请解释每句代码的作用type SysUserById struct dtoObjectById commonControlByfunc s SysUserById GetId interface if lensIds 0 sIds = appendsIds sId return sIds return sIdfunc
- 定义了一个名为SysUserById的结构体,其中包含了dto.ObjectById和common.ControlBy两个结构体的成员变量。
- GetId()函数的作用是获取SysUserById结构体中的Ids和Id成员变量,如果Ids不为空,则将Ids和Id合并成一个切片并返回,否则返回Id。
- GenerateM()函数的作用是生成一个common.ActiveRecord类型的对象,该对象是models.SysUser的实例,用于操作数据库中的SysUser表。
原文地址: https://www.cveoy.top/t/topic/bAHG 著作权归作者所有。请勿转载和采集!